Fluminense agree new deal with youth team centre-back

On Monday, Fluminense announced the contract renewal with defender Davi Schuindt, 21 years old. A product of the club’s youth academy, the player signed a deal until December 2028.

“I’m very happy to be renewing my contract. It’s a dream and, thank God, I’ve been given opportunities with the professional team. I’m trying to give my best in training and matches to achieve good results for Fluminense,” he said.

Born in Cabo Frio, Davi Schuindt joined Fluminense in 2013. The defender won the Brazilian U-17 championship and the Rio de Janeiro U-20 championship in 2020 and 2022, respectively.

This season, Davi made his debut with the professional team and has already played four matches for Fluminense. He appeared in two games in the Campeonato Carioca and two more in the Brasileirão, with one win, two draws, and one loss.
